2.Officers Ultra Compact Tripod
The second DSLR tripod on my rundown became obvious after a few client remarks when I distributed a famous travel tripod survey prior this year. The Rangers 57″ Ultra Compact Aluminum Tripod is promoted as a ‘perfect DSLR tripod for movement and work’. Tipping the scales at just 1 kg 315 g (2.89 lbs.), this tripod is certainly on the lighter finish of the scale, yet not to its point feeling unstable.
Officers have chosen to focus its endeavors on the attempted and-tried Ball Head configuration, which means no handles for panning and inclining your camera, yet then again, an a lot lighter, more conservative in general structure. Development of the Ball Head is controlled by means of a twitting handle as an afterthought. Over this is another handle that delivers the plate that connects to your camera, and furthermore houses one of two air pocket levels.
The swiveling appendage permits an inclining scope of – 45°/+90° and a full 360° dish, with everything released and fixed utilizing a different panning lock – another handle on the Rangers 57″ Ultra Compact Aluminum Tripod. Everything moves around easily and bolts safely. It’s consistently prudent to hold your camera with one hand while making the ball head changes with the other, to guarantee your camera doesn’t simply ‘drop’ set up when relaxing the different handles.
With a base expanded stature of 38.5cm (15″) and a greatest tallness of 1m 40cm (55″), the Rangers Ultra Compact Aluminum Tripod can fall to simply 35cm (14″), making it the ideal size to store inside your camera pack. The 4 segment aluminum combination legs feel solid and durable in any event, when completely expanded, and highlight snappy delivery flip-locks for quick activity. One of the legs likewise includes an agreeable froth grasp, making the tripod simpler to hold during cold or wet conditions.
3.JOBY GorillaPod SLR Zoom
I feel like the notorious GorillaPod needs no presentation. This being the first DSLR tripod I at any point purchased, the GorillaPod is an adaptable smaller than usual tripod that is frequently imitated however only here and there bettered.
Fabricated out of clinical evaluation Japanese ABS plastic, treated steel and German TPE elastic, the Joby GorillaPod is a great item that is worked to last.
The fundamental thought of having a tripod whose legs can be flexed, turned and twisted around itself is so you can tie down it to places that customary tripods can’t be made sure about – tree limbs, table legs, road posts, your own arm… essentially anything that is sufficiently tight.
With 10 moveable leg joints on every leg canvassed in grippe elastic, the Joby GorillaPod SLR Zoom folds over articles safely, depending on the solidness between each joint to wait. The speedy delivery plate remains associated with your camera so you can slide it on and off the ball head rapidly. While some base plates depend upon a ‘key screw’ to make sure about to a camera, the GorillaPod’s recoveries a little weight here, requiring rather a coin, key, or screwdriver to bend it.
After your camera is made sure about to the ball head, you turn an elastic secured handle as an afterthought to dish and tilt your camera up to 360°, at that point contort it again to make sure about it in position. The adaptable, trappable legs can securely hold any DSLR up to 3 kg (6 lbs.) or any of the mirrorless cameras on this rundown. This implies even picture takers shooting with heavier full edge cameras and long range focal points can depend on the quality of the GorillaPod SLR Zoom to help their apparatus in any insane position they pick.
